Dominant Markets & Segments in Industrial Gearbox Industry
The Industrial Gearbox Industry exhibits distinct dominance across various regions and application segments, driven by economic policies, infrastructure development, and specific industry needs. Asia Pacific, particularly China, stands out as the dominant region due to its expansive manufacturing base and significant investments in infrastructure and industrialization. The Power Industry and the Steel Industry are the largest application segments, accounting for a substantial portion of the market share, estimated to be over 40% combined. These sectors require highly robust and efficient gearboxes for continuous operation and heavy-duty applications.
Within the Type segmentation, Helical Gearboxes and Planetary Gearboxes hold significant market share, owing to their versatility, high efficiency, and compact design, catering to a wide range of applications. Worm Gearboxes remain crucial for applications requiring high reduction ratios and self-locking capabilities, particularly in material handling and lifting equipment. The Mines and Minerals Industry is another key segment experiencing substantial growth, driven by global demand for raw materials and the increasing need for reliable equipment in harsh environments. Wastewater Treatment Industry, while smaller, shows steady growth due to ongoing infrastructure upgrades and environmental regulations.

Industrial Gearbox Industry Product Innovations
Product innovations in the Industrial Gearbox Industry are increasingly focused on enhancing energy efficiency, durability, and intelligence. Manufacturers are developing gearboxes with improved lubrication systems and advanced materials, such as high-strength alloys and coatings, to reduce friction and wear, leading to extended service life and reduced maintenance costs. The integration of smart sensors and IoT connectivity is a significant trend, enabling real-time monitoring of operational parameters like temperature, vibration, and torque, facilitating predictive maintenance and optimizing performance. These innovations provide a competitive advantage by offering customers solutions that minimize downtime and operational expenses.

Key Developments in Industrial Gearbox Industry Sector
- May 2023: Triumph Group, Inc. secured a long-term agreement from General Electric (GE) for its Geared Solutions business, covering LEAP-1A, LEAP-1B, and LEAP-1C programs. This extension signifies a continued collaboration with GE on Integrated Gearboxes (IGBs) for over 35 years, with Triumph having shipped over 25,000 gearboxes. Triumph is expected to supply thousands of IGBs annually to GE for the next decade, reinforcing its market position.
- January 2023: Airbus Helicopters announced the acquisition of ZF Luftfahrttechnik from ZF Friedrichshafen. This strategic move aims to bolster Airbus's transmission production and overhaul capabilities for its H145 and H135 helicopter programs, enhancing its vertical integration and supply chain control.
